Output 8dd4fcba183dd0ddcf0b295bd51b250aebbcb64e2e154dea7425aece91ac7119:0

value
17809243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e84aee084b81eb23475bbdeb19bc142267a8653 OP_EQUAL
address
3G9BdqWvRPvuUwgg5hhgaRywAadXxUAjMX
transaction
8dd4fcba183dd0ddcf0b295bd51b250aebbcb64e2e154dea7425aece91ac7119
confirmations
334782
spent
true